While on European soil, all eyes were on the famous Prague Playoffs, this past weekend also saw another round of top-level jumping on American soil! The World Cup stage of Los Angeles was on the programme at Arcadia's Santa Anita Park in California. There, the mare Bisquetta once again showed her class by jumping to a top ranking under the saddle of her rider Laura Kraut at the Longines FEI Jumping World Cup!

The Longines FEI Jumping World Cup on Saturday evening formed the absolute highlight of the weekend in Arcadia, bringing a total of 40 combinations to the start. The 1.60m high base course had a lot of challenges and in the end, seven combinations managed to get through the base course unscathed. One of those seven combinations who managed to join that group was American rider Laura Kraut and her 11-year-old top mare Bisquetta, a daughter of Bisquet Balou C van de Mispelaere and Takashi van Berkenbroeck who was born as Bisquetta Squalls Estate Z to breeder Claire McCarthy-Winters. Kraut and Bisquetta, who had also produced a clear round in the 1.50 m main class on Thursday, also kept it nicely clear in the jump-off and with a finishing time of 36.02 seconds they eventually secured 4th place in the standings.

Besides Laura Kraut, her compatriot Kent Farrington also managed to qualify for the jump-off with his 11-year-old top mare Toulayna, the daughter of Toulon and Parco who was given the birth name Toulayna van het Bloesemhof Z by breeder Jasper Doucé. Farrington and Toulayna managed to set the third fastest finishing time in 34.72 seconds, but a mistake on the way ultimately kept them off the podium and made them settle for sixth place.

Finally, Irish rider James Chawke also managed to jump into the picture again with the 11-year-old mare Daido van 't Ruytershof Z, a daughter of our stallion Dieu Merci van T&L Z and Bamako de Muze from the breeding of Bert van den Branden of Stal 't Ruytershof. Chawke and Daido van 't Ruytershof Z, still good for a win at the three-star competition in Arcadi the week before, rushed to the finish line in 59.46 seconds during the 1.45m class on Friday, taking a handsome2nd place this time.
